Merge tag 'drm-next-2020-10-15' of git://anongit.freedesktop.org/drm/drm
Pull drm updates from Dave Airlie: "Not a major amount of change, the i915 trees got split into display and gt trees to better facilitate higher level review, and there's a major refactoring of i915 GEM locking to use more core kernel concepts (like ww-mutexes). msm gets per-process pagetables, older AMD SI cards get DC support, nouveau got a bump in displayport support with common code extraction from i915. Outside of drm this contains a couple of patches for hexint moduleparams which you've acked, and a virtio common code tree that you should also get via it's regular path.
